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Louisville Airport (SDF), USA and Creation Museum, KY, USA?

There is no direct connection from Louisville Airport (SDF) to Creation Museum. However, you can take the line 02 bus to S 5th @ W Jefferson, walk to W Jefferson @ S 6th, take the line 10 bus to W Broadway @ S 10th, walk to Louisville, KY Bus Station, take the bus to Cincinnati - Downtown, then take the taxi to Creation Museum. Alternatively, Mozio operates a vehicle from Louisville-SDF to Creation Museum on demand, and the journey takes 1h 52m.
